Introduction

My neighborhood, a microcosm of a bustling urban environment, reflects a diverse tapestry of culture, history, and socio-economic dynamics. Nestled within a city's sprawling landscape, it is a vibrant amalgamation of residential tranquility and commercial vitality. The interplay of architectural styles, ranging from Victorian-era houses to modern high-rise apartments, underscores the historical evolution and demographic shifts that have shaped the area. This essay endeavors to provide an in-depth analysis of my neighborhood, examining its socio-cultural milieu, infrastructural developments, and community dynamics. By employing a multidisciplinary approach, I aim to elucidate the complexities and nuances that define this locality, offering insights into both its strengths and challenges. Furthermore, understanding the neighborhood’s identity through its historical context, community initiatives, and future potential allows for a comprehensive appreciation of its place within the broader urban fabric.

Socio-Cultural Fabric: Diversity and Identity

The socio-cultural landscape of my neighborhood is characterized by its rich diversity, a testament to the waves of immigration and demographic shifts over decades. According to the latest census data, over 60% of the neighborhood's population comprises ethnic minorities, with significant representations from Asian, Hispanic, and African communities. This multiculturalism is palpably reflected in the neighborhood's culinary offerings, festivals, and community events, which celebrate a multitude of traditions and cuisines. As urban sociologist Jane Jacobs posits, "Great cities are not static, they constantly change and evolve," and my neighborhood exemplifies this dynamism (Jacobs, 1961).

The neighborhood's identity is further reinforced through community-driven initiatives aimed at fostering inclusivity and cultural exchange. For instance, the annual Multicultural Festival serves as a platform for residents to showcase their heritage, thereby strengthening communal ties. These initiatives not only celebrate diversity but also address social cohesion challenges, as evidenced by the decline in neighborhood disputes reported by the local council. However, the presence of such diversity also invites challenges, particularly in the form of cultural assimilation and integration. Critics argue that while multiculturalism enriches the community, it can also lead to fragmentation if not managed effectively. Therefore, balancing cultural preservation with integration remains a critical task for community leaders.

Transitioning from the social aspects, the neighborhood's identity is also intertwined with its historical architecture. The juxtaposition of old and new structures serves as a visual narrative of its evolution. Victorian houses, often adorned with ornate facades, stand alongside sleek, modern buildings, symbolizing the seamless blend of tradition and modernity. This architectural diversity not only enhances the aesthetic appeal but also contributes to a unique neighborhood character that attracts both residents and visitors alike.

Infrastructural Development: Balancing Growth and Sustainability

Infrastructural development within my neighborhood has been a double-edged sword, offering enhanced amenities while posing sustainability challenges. Over the past decade, significant investments have been made in public transport, green spaces, and commercial centers, aligning with urban planners' vision of a more connected and livable environment. The introduction of a new subway line, for instance, has greatly improved accessibility, reducing commute times and promoting economic activity. As urban planner Peter Calthorpe asserts, "Transit-oriented development is the key to sustainable urban growth" (Calthorpe, 1993).

Nonetheless, rapid development has raised concerns regarding environmental sustainability and community displacement. The construction of high-rise apartments, though addressing housing shortages, has led to the gentrification of certain areas, displacing long-standing residents. Moreover, increased vehicular traffic and construction activities have contributed to environmental degradation, contradicting the sustainability goals espoused by local authorities. To mitigate these issues, the neighborhood has embraced green building initiatives and expanded its network of parks, promoting ecological balance and enhancing quality of life.

Transitioning to the digital realm, technological advancements have also played a pivotal role in shaping the neighborhood's infrastructure. The proliferation of smart city technologies, including IoT-enabled street lighting and waste management systems, has optimized resource utilization and improved service delivery. However, the digital divide remains a pertinent issue, with lower-income residents facing barriers to accessing these technologies. Addressing this divide is crucial to ensuring equitable benefits from infrastructural advancements, thereby fostering a more inclusive community.

Community Dynamics: Participation and Empowerment

Community dynamics in my neighborhood are marked by active participation and empowerment, driven by a robust network of local organizations and advocacy groups. These entities play a vital role in addressing residents' needs, from organizing neighborhood watch programs to advocating for policy changes at the municipal level. According to a study by the Urban Institute, neighborhoods with high levels of civic participation tend to experience greater social cohesion and resilience (Urban Institute, 2018).

One exemplary case is the neighborhood association's successful campaign to establish a community center, which now serves as a hub for educational programs, recreational activities, and social services. This initiative not only addressed a critical gap in community resources but also fostered a sense of ownership and empowerment among residents. Conversely, while these organizations have made significant strides, challenges persist in engaging marginalized communities and ensuring equitable representation in decision-making processes.

Transitioning to the broader societal context, the role of digital platforms in enhancing community engagement cannot be overstated. Social media and online forums have facilitated real-time communication and collaboration, enabling residents to voice concerns and propose solutions effectively. However, the digital sphere also presents challenges, such as misinformation and digital exclusion, which can hinder constructive dialogue. Thus, striking a balance between digital and traditional engagement methods is essential for sustaining community-driven progress.

Conclusion

In conclusion, my neighborhood represents a complex tapestry of socio-cultural diversity, infrastructural development, and community dynamics. Its rich cultural mosaic and historical legacy are both its strengths and challenges, requiring careful navigation and management. While infrastructural advancements have improved accessibility and quality of life, they also necessitate a commitment to sustainability and inclusivity. Community participation remains a cornerstone of neighborhood resilience, yet ongoing efforts are needed to engage all residents equitably. As urban environments continue to evolve, my neighborhood stands as a microcosm of broader societal trends and challenges, offering valuable insights into the interplay between diversity, development, and community empowerment. By embracing these complexities and fostering a collaborative spirit, the neighborhood can continue to thrive as a vibrant and inclusive urban enclave.
